Jen Psaki Reveals She Plans to Step Down as Biden Press Secretary Next Year

Source: mediaite.com


By Colby Hall May 6th, 2021, 2:14 pm
128 Comments


Alex Wong/Getty Images

White House Press Secretary Jen Psaki revealed in an hour-long interview with David Axelrod that she intends to step down from her role after serving only “roughly” one year.

Psaki’s plans aren’t that out of the ordinary. Administrations typically work through a number of people in that very high stress and manic-paced role; for example, the Trump administration saw four separate Press Secretaries serve former President Donald Trump.

Psaki’s comments came during a conversation with host David Axelrod (with whom she worked during the Obama administration) that she is undaunted by the challenge and the responsibility (which she says she loves), but when she discussed the role with the Biden transition team, it was about serving roughly a one-year term. “I think it’s going to be time for somebody else to have this job, in a year from now or about a year from now,” she said....................................

45. Rarely does a press secretary serve out one term, let alone two.
Thu May 6, 2021, 06:23 PM
May 2021

The longest serving is James Hagerty, who was there for eight years.

More recently, as the role has evolved, turnover has increased.

Clinton had 5
Bush had 4
Obama had 3
Trump had 4
